Public Member Functions | Private Member Functions | Private Attributes | Friends
youbot::SmartEnergyCurrentUpStep Class Reference

#include <YouBotGripperParameter.hpp>

Inheritance diagram for youbot::SmartEnergyCurrentUpStep:
Inheritance graph
[legend]

List of all members.

Public Member Functions

void getParameter (unsigned int &parameter) const
void setParameter (const unsigned int &parameter)
 SmartEnergyCurrentUpStep ()
void toString (std::string &value) const
virtual ~SmartEnergyCurrentUpStep ()

Private Member Functions

std::string getName () const
ParameterType getType () const
void getYouBotMailboxMsg (YouBotSlaveMailboxMsg &message) const
void setYouBotMailboxMsg (const YouBotSlaveMailboxMsg &message)

Private Attributes

unsigned int lowerLimit
std::string name
ParameterType parameterType
unsigned int upperLimit
unsigned int value

Friends

class YouBotGripper
class YouBotGripperBar

Detailed Description

Sets the current increment step. The current becomes incremented for each measured stallGuard2 value below the lower threshold (see smartEnergy hysteresis start). current increment step size: Scaling: 0... 3: 1, 2, 4, 8 0: slow increment 3: fast increment / fast reaction to rising load

Definition at line 1797 of file YouBotGripperParameter.hpp.


Constructor & Destructor Documentation

Definition at line 2232 of file YouBotGripperParameter.cpp.

Definition at line 2242 of file YouBotGripperParameter.cpp.


Member Function Documentation

std::string youbot::SmartEnergyCurrentUpStep::getName ( ) const [inline, private, virtual]

Implements youbot::YouBotGripperParameter.

Definition at line 1817 of file YouBotGripperParameter.hpp.

void youbot::SmartEnergyCurrentUpStep::getParameter ( unsigned int &  parameter) const

Definition at line 2248 of file YouBotGripperParameter.cpp.

ParameterType youbot::SmartEnergyCurrentUpStep::getType ( ) const [inline, private, virtual]

Implements youbot::YouBotGripperParameter.

Definition at line 1823 of file YouBotGripperParameter.hpp.

Implements youbot::YouBotGripperParameter.

Definition at line 2280 of file YouBotGripperParameter.cpp.

void youbot::SmartEnergyCurrentUpStep::setParameter ( const unsigned int &  parameter)

Definition at line 2255 of file YouBotGripperParameter.cpp.

Implements youbot::YouBotGripperParameter.

Definition at line 2288 of file YouBotGripperParameter.cpp.

void youbot::SmartEnergyCurrentUpStep::toString ( std::string &  value) const [virtual]

Implements youbot::YouBotGripperParameter.

Definition at line 2271 of file YouBotGripperParameter.cpp.


Friends And Related Function Documentation

friend class YouBotGripper [friend]

Reimplemented from youbot::YouBotGripperParameter.

Definition at line 1799 of file YouBotGripperParameter.hpp.

friend class YouBotGripperBar [friend]

Reimplemented from youbot::YouBotGripperParameter.

Definition at line 1800 of file YouBotGripperParameter.hpp.


Member Data Documentation

Definition at line 1831 of file YouBotGripperParameter.hpp.

Reimplemented from youbot::YouBotGripperParameter.

Definition at line 1835 of file YouBotGripperParameter.hpp.

Reimplemented from youbot::YouBotGripperParameter.

Definition at line 1837 of file YouBotGripperParameter.hpp.

Definition at line 1827 of file YouBotGripperParameter.hpp.

Definition at line 1833 of file YouBotGripperParameter.hpp.


The documentation for this class was generated from the following files:


youbot_driver
Author(s): Jan Paulus
autogenerated on Mon Oct 6 2014 09:08:04